Nick and Judy's undeniable chemistry has led to some unique fan video edits online, and the cast and director of Zootopia 2 find themselves quite intrigued by the response. Voiced by Jason Bateman and Ginnifer Goodwin, respectively, the pair started off in the 2016 Disney hit on opposite sides of the law, with the fox character getting through life as a con artist while the latter a rookie officer in the Zootopia Police Department.
After a nine-year wait, Nick and Judy are back in Zootopia 2, with the two now working as partners in the ZPD. After their efforts to bring down a smuggling ring fall apart, the two come to suspect a potential snake as being the real culprit behind their failed case, setting off in search of him and a way to clear their names. Hitting theaters in time for Thanksgiving, Zootopia 2 has garnered rave reviews from critics, only falling a few points shy of the original on Rotten Tomatoes.
In anticipation of the movie's release, ScreenRant's Ash Crossan interviewed Ginnifer Goodwin, Jason Bateman and returning director Byron Howard to discuss Zootopia 2. The group were asked their thoughts on fans of the franchise shipping Nick and Judy as a romantic pairing, colloquially dubbed WildeHopps, to which Goodwin reveals she was the one who informed Bateman of the fan edits in the lead up to their press tour, including many calling Bateman's character "the perfect boyfriend":
Ginnifer Goodwin: I told him this is a thing! It's a thing. Well, I was telling him that there's a "Hey, girl" Nick Wilde thing that I was told about in the hair salon recently. There's entire social media feeds. Is that the term? I feel like I'm 90 right now.
Jokingly calling Goodwin a "Grandma" for her uncertainty over how to describe social media, Bateman went on to confess being unsure how he feels about the WildeHopps shipping, wondering what fans of the characters were focusing on, pondering if Nick wearing a loose tie "is a good thing." Goodwin went on to express it being "very confusing" at there being "millions and millions [of views]" for the edits of the pair, which is "more than some of the work we do."
Howard went on to feel that the reason for the passionate fan shipping is that Nick and Judy have "really unique" chemistry, which he credits to the fact that Goodwin and Bateman are "by nature, such good actors." The director went on to look back at the original Zootopia, in which the characters "started as Natural Enemies," before the script and story worked to play into the core formula of "great buddy movies":
Byron Howard: [They] are really built around contrast, and we wanted to make sure we held onto that and let them keep growing. In addition to just making them fun characters, we really grounded them. I believe that these guys have souls. They have experiences that they're bringing to the table, and there are obstacles that they're going to run into. They're very real, I think.
While the movie on paper is a buddy comedy, the first Zootopia certainly laid a lot of groundwork for a potential romance between Nick and Judy. Between their charismatic quipping with one another, Judy's expression of love for Bateman's character in the ending, and a deleted storyboard scene showing Goodwin's protagonist introducing Nick to her family, and them all mistaking him for her boyfriend, fans of the film hoping for their shipping coming true had enough weight behind them.
Even Zootopia 2 toyed with a potential romance between the two. The film picks up a week after the first film's ending, and sees Nick and Judy struggling to work together as partners, with the duo subsequently having to attend partner therapy to improve their relationship. Their going on the run for much of the movie's runtime not only further tests their relationship, but also requires them to learn from one another in a way many romantic pairings do in storytelling.

Posts By Shawn S. Lealos 1 day agoWithout getting into spoilers, it's safe to say some WildeHopps shippers are sure to be disappointed by Zootopia 2's ending. That being said, with the sequel leaving the door open on a very specific note, not only can Nick and Judy find themselves with another case to solve, but also potentially explore a new facet to their relationship.
